- [ ] Step 7: Archive cold storage buckets (Glacierline tier). Confirm both ceremony witnesses are present, verify bucket manifests match the Oxbow ledger, then seal the archive key shares. Plugin authors may observe but not handle shares. Once sealed, the archive index itself is encrypted and can only be reopened with the passphrase below.

vault phrase of badup-hahig = tamael-aldael-kelmir-istael-fenok-istwyn-tamius-jorath-oliion

Hi support folks — handing PixelRinse (our image EXIF scrubbing service) from me to Tomas. Quick context: it strips location and device metadata from every upload before storage. If a customer reports metadata leaking, check the scrub queue first — nine times out of ten it's a stuck worker. Restarts are safe and idempotent. For reference when debugging tickets, the service currently runs with the following configuration.

deployment values, fahip-yahog:
[sorax]
port = 3306
region = west-3
host = sorax.qirvansys.internal
timeout_ms = 750
retries = 3

### Runbook: Currency Rounding Drift (Coinlathe)

If ledgers drift by sub-cent amounts after a conversion batch, it's almost always the half-even rounding flag getting reset in config. Check the converter's rounding mode first, then re-run reconciliation on the affected day only. Don't patch totals by hand — reviewers will bounce it. Confirm you're on the fixed build by checking the token printed below.

pipeline stamp: htk9_ce63042d9

MEMO — Kettling Depot Receiving

Uniform sets for the new Kettling depot arrive Wednesday via Ashgrove courier: 40 boxes, sorted by size, manifest attached to box one. Check the count at the dock before signing; shortages go straight to stores, not the courier. The hand-over instruction the courier will follow is set out below.

drop instructions, tafof-baguf: the holmir gilox courier leaves the sormir ulaok holdor ledger at gate 5596 under passcode 257343

### Step 2: Point your plugin at the new Quillbus broker

Quillbus 4.x drops the old handshake, so plugins built against 3.x won't connect — rebuild against the v4 SDK first. Queue names are unchanged, but dead-letter routing is now automatic. To migrate any persisted plugin state, connect to the broker's state database using the string below.

replica DSN, tawef-hahap: mysql://eliix_svc:FiIC0jz@db-394a.lumiclabs.internal:5432/holius